Commercial Slab Construction in Rockville, MD
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of solid, durable concrete foundations for a variety of business and industrial projects. These services typically cover the installation of concrete slabs for warehouses, retail spaces, manufacturing facilities, parking lots, and other large-scale structures. Property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including the preparation process, materials used, and how the slab will support the intended use. Clarifying the size, load capacity, and any specific site requirements helps ensure the foundation meets the needs of the property.
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ners often seek information about site conditions, such as soil stability and drainage considerations, as well as the project's design specifications. They may also inquire about permits, timeline estimates, and how the work integrates with other construction phases. Having a clear understanding of these factors helps ensure the project proceeds smoothly and results in a stable, long-lasting foundation suitable for the property's purpose.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, walkways, and loading docks on business properties in Rockville, MD.
What materials are used for commercial slab construction? Concrete is the primary material, often reinforced with steel to ensure durability and support heavy loads.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ness varies based on the project, but typically ranges from 4 to 12 inches, depending on load requirements and usage.
What should property owners consider before construction? Proper site preparation, soil conditions, and load expectations are key factors in planning a durable and effective commercial slab.
